“I started to fool around a bit with the articles and then they told me that it’s not a Time standard, the text does not read so and so. In my very bad English, I tried to explain to them that the English copy represents 30 percent gray area to me and thus I act accordingly. If I didn’t have an accent in America, I would have to invent one, because in this way they never know if I really thought what I said or they just didn’t understand me all that well.”
—mirko ilić
“Every Saturday, in the early morning hours, when we were finishing up Time, the editor-in-chief would come to us and thank us for a job well done. It did not matter if it was just a courtesy, it meant a lot to us at three o’clock in the morning.”
—mirko ilić, “a kid that’s doodling something,” nedeljna dalmacija, june 01, 1992
